Gala Benefit Concert and Silent Auction THIS WEEKEND

 

 
 
Do you have your tickets yet for Saturday night's Annual Gala Benefit Concert and Silent Auction?  The show is this Saturday night, November 3rd, 7:30 at the Fogelberg Performing Arts Center at Burlington High School (781-A-FUN-TIC for ticket sales).  A great night of Disney music, featuring the BHS Marching Band, the Concert and Silent Auction guarantees a fun evening of entertainment and perhaps even some early holiday gift items during the intermission's Silent Auction.
